<h2 bis_size='{"x":8,"y":448,"w":636,"h":20,"abs_x":310,"abs_y":1441}'><a name="_jxvpc8m2wmm7" style="background-image: url('data:image/svg+xml;charset=UTF-8,%3Csvg%20width%3D'8'%20height%3D'12'%20xmlns%3D'http%3A%2F%2Fwww.w3.org%2F2000%2Fsvg'%3E%3Cpath%20d%3D'M0%200L8%200%208%2012%204.09117821%209%200%2012z'%2F%3E%3C%2Fsvg%3E%0A');" bis_label="style" bis_size='{"x":8,"y":453,"w":12,"h":12,"abs_x":310,"abs_y":1446}' rel="nofollow"></a><span lang="EN" bis_size='{"x":20,"y":446,"w":302,"h":23,"abs_x":322,"abs_y":1439}'>For Colder Australian Regions<p bis_size='{"x":322,"y":446,"w":0,"h":23,"abs_x":624,"abs_y":1439}'></p></span></h2>
<p class="MsoNormal" bis_size='{"x":8,"y":485,"w":636,"h":100,"abs_x":310,"abs_y":1478}'><span lang="EN" bis_size='{"x":8,"y":487,"w":628,"h":96,"abs_x":310,"abs_y":1480}'>If youre living in the colder regions of Australia like Hobart, Melbourne, Adelaide, and Canberra which are considered the colder Australian regions with Melbourne having 10C of temperature and is known to be the coldest mainland capital city. Hobart ranks as Australia's chilliest location overall, with dry bulb temperatures averaging 8.94C, compounded by high tree canopy coverage and limited solar exposure that creates a particularly damp, cold environment.<p bis_size='{"x":383,"y":567,"w":0,"h":16,"abs_x":685,"abs_y":1560}'></p></span></p>
<p class="MsoNormal" bis_size='{"x":8,"y":599,"w":636,"h":20,"abs_x":310,"abs_y":1592}'><span lang="EN" bis_size='{"x":8,"y":601,"w":587,"h":16,"abs_x":310,"abs_y":1594}'>With these kinds of climates, you wanna choose a knitwear with insulation and keep you warm. <p bis_size='{"x":595,"y":601,"w":0,"h":16,"abs_x":897,"abs_y":1594}'></p></span></p>
<h3 bis_size='{"x":8,"y":636,"w":636,"h":20,"abs_x":310,"abs_y":1629}'><a name="_sbo6zw4mqahe" style="background-image: url('data:image/svg+xml;charset=UTF-8,%3Csvg%20width%3D'8'%20height%3D'12'%20xmlns%3D'http%3A%2F%2Fwww.w3.org%2F2000%2Fsvg'%3E%3Cpath%20d%3D'M0%200L8%200%208%2012%204.09117821%209%200%2012z'%2F%3E%3C%2Fsvg%3E%0A');" bis_label="style" bis_size='{"x":8,"y":640,"w":12,"h":12,"abs_x":310,"abs_y":1633}' rel="nofollow"></a><span lang="EN" bis_size='{"x":20,"y":637,"w":206,"h":18,"abs_x":322,"abs_y":1630}'>Wool and merino Knitwear<p bis_size='{"x":226,"y":637,"w":0,"h":18,"abs_x":528,"abs_y":1630}'></p></span></h3>
<p class="MsoNormal" bis_size='{"x":8,"y":672,"w":636,"h":60,"abs_x":310,"abs_y":1665}'><span lang="EN" bis_size='{"x":8,"y":674,"w":624,"h":56,"abs_x":310,"abs_y":1667}'>Pure wool with the blend of merino knitwear are perfect for you as theyll be breathable while keeping you cozy and look for chunky or cable-knit ones that have a design for extra coziness and trapping heat. <p bis_size='{"x":39,"y":714,"w":0,"h":16,"abs_x":341,"abs_y":1707}'></p></span></p>
<h3 bis_size='{"x":8,"y":748,"w":636,"h":20,"abs_x":310,"abs_y":1741}'><a name="_rw4b8tacyxyu" style="background-image: url('data:image/svg+xml;charset=UTF-8,%3Csvg%20width%3D'8'%20height%3D'12'%20xmlns%3D'http%3A%2F%2Fwww.w3.org%2F2000%2Fsvg'%3E%3Cpath%20d%3D'M0%200L8%200%208%2012%204.09117821%209%200%2012z'%2F%3E%3C%2Fsvg%3E%0A');" bis_label="style" bis_size='{"x":8,"y":752,"w":12,"h":12,"abs_x":310,"abs_y":1745}' rel="nofollow"></a><span lang="EN" bis_size='{"x":20,"y":749,"w":53,"h":18,"abs_x":322,"abs_y":1742}'>Alpaca<p bis_size='{"x":73,"y":749,"w":0,"h":18,"abs_x":375,"abs_y":1742}'></p></span></h3>
<p class="MsoNormal" bis_size='{"x":8,"y":785,"w":636,"h":60,"abs_x":310,"abs_y":1778}'><span lang="EN" bis_size='{"x":8,"y":787,"w":622,"h":56,"abs_x":310,"abs_y":1780}'>It has a great warmth to weight ratio and is great for insulation and extreme warmth, its soft and also water resistant as well. Its suitable for individuals who are wool sensitive because of its minimal lenonin, its also flame resistant. But its not suitable for the mild winter areas. <p bis_size='{"x":484,"y":827,"w":0,"h":16,"abs_x":786,"abs_y":1820}'></p></span></p>
<h3 bis_size='{"x":8,"y":861,"w":636,"h":20,"abs_x":310,"abs_y":1854}'><a name="_jrrusajaz99" style="background-image: url('data:image/svg+xml;charset=UTF-8,%3Csvg%20width%3D'8'%20height%3D'12'%20xmlns%3D'http%3A%2F%2Fwww.w3.org%2F2000%2Fsvg'%3E%3Cpath%20d%3D'M0%200L8%200%208%2012%204.09117821%209%200%2012z'%2F%3E%3C%2Fsvg%3E%0A');" bis_label="style" bis_size='{"x":8,"y":865,"w":12,"h":12,"abs_x":310,"abs_y":1858}' rel="nofollow"></a><span lang="EN" bis_size='{"x":20,"y":862,"w":206,"h":18,"abs_x":322,"abs_y":1855}'>Turtlenecks and cardigans<p bis_size='{"x":226,"y":862,"w":0,"h":18,"abs_x":528,"abs_y":1855}'></p></span></h3>
<p class="MsoNormal" bis_size='{"x":8,"y":897,"w":636,"h":40,"abs_x":310,"abs_y":1890}'><span lang="EN" bis_size='{"x":8,"y":899,"w":581,"h":36,"abs_x":310,"abs_y":1892}'>When its getting cold and then hot, you can buy a fine-gauge heavy knitwear turtleneck with a cardigan or blazer to throw off the cardigan to adapt to the weather. <p bis_size='{"x":424,"y":919,"w":0,"h":16,"abs_x":726,"abs_y":1912}'></p></span></p>
<h2 bis_size='{"x":8,"y":955,"w":636,"h":20,"abs_x":310,"abs_y":1948}'><a name="_n2lle5xhnkus" style="background-image: url('data:image/svg+xml;charset=UTF-8,%3Csvg%20width%3D'8'%20height%3D'12'%20xmlns%3D'http%3A%2F%2Fwww.w3.org%2F2000%2Fsvg'%3E%3Cpath%20d%3D'M0%200L8%200%208%2012%204.09117821%209%200%2012z'%2F%3E%3C%2Fsvg%3E%0A');" bis_label="style" bis_size='{"x":8,"y":960,"w":12,"h":12,"abs_x":310,"abs_y":1953}' rel="nofollow"></a><span lang="EN" bis_size='{"x":20,"y":953,"w":294,"h":23,"abs_x":322,"abs_y":1946}'>Mild Climate Australian Areas<p bis_size='{"x":314,"y":953,"w":0,"h":23,"abs_x":616,"abs_y":1946}'></p></span><span lang="EN" bis_size='{"x":314,"y":953,"w":0,"h":23,"abs_x":616,"abs_y":1946}'></span></h2>
<p bis_size='{"x":8,"y":992,"w":636,"h":60,"abs_x":310,"abs_y":1985}'><span lang="EN" bis_size='{"x":8,"y":994,"w":606,"h":56,"abs_x":310,"abs_y":1987}'>Central and eastern coastlines with Sydney, having 13C and Adelaide and Perth temperatures ranging from 7 to 18C are mild climate areas, this is where you need more of lightweight knitwear selection for warmth but not too much overheating.</span></p>
<h3 bis_size='{"x":8,"y":1069,"w":636,"h":20,"abs_x":310,"abs_y":2062}'><a name="_895110iiasr4" style="background-image: url('data:image/svg+xml;charset=UTF-8,%3Csvg%20width%3D'8'%20height%3D'12'%20xmlns%3D'http%3A%2F%2Fwww.w3.org%2F2000%2Fsvg'%3E%3Cpath%20d%3D'M0%200L8%200%208%2012%204.09117821%209%200%2012z'%2F%3E%3C%2Fsvg%3E%0A');" bis_label="style" bis_size='{"x":8,"y":1073,"w":12,"h":12,"abs_x":310,"abs_y":2066}' rel="nofollow"></a><span lang="EN" bis_size='{"x":20,"y":1070,"w":171,"h":18,"abs_x":322,"abs_y":2063}'>Start with the layering<p bis_size='{"x":191,"y":1070,"w":0,"h":18,"abs_x":493,"abs_y":2063}'></p></span></h3>
<p class="MsoNormal" bis_size='{"x":8,"y":1105,"w":636,"h":40,"abs_x":310,"abs_y":2098}'><span lang="EN" bis_size='{"x":8,"y":1107,"w":627,"h":36,"abs_x":310,"abs_y":2100}'>You should start with the lightweight base layer and then wear a warm sweater and knitwear on top of that so you can take off the layer if the weather gets hot. <p bis_size='{"x":355,"y":1127,"w":0,"h":16,"abs_x":657,"abs_y":2120}'></p></span></p>
<h3 bis_size='{"x":8,"y":1161,"w":636,"h":20,"abs_x":310,"abs_y":2154}'><a name="_9xs4xjehzvrl" style="background-image: url('data:image/svg+xml;charset=UTF-8,%3Csvg%20width%3D'8'%20height%3D'12'%20xmlns%3D'http%3A%2F%2Fwww.w3.org%2F2000%2Fsvg'%3E%3Cpath%20d%3D'M0%200L8%200%208%2012%204.09117821%209%200%2012z'%2F%3E%3C%2Fsvg%3E%0A');" bis_label="style" bis_size='{"x":8,"y":1165,"w":12,"h":12,"abs_x":310,"abs_y":2158}' rel="nofollow"></a><span lang="EN" bis_size='{"x":20,"y":1162,"w":200,"h":18,"abs_x":322,"abs_y":2155}'>Cotton blended knitwears<p bis_size='{"x":220,"y":1162,"w":0,"h":18,"abs_x":522,"abs_y":2155}'></p></span></h3>
<p class="MsoNormal" bis_size='{"x":8,"y":1198,"w":636,"h":60,"abs_x":310,"abs_y":2191}'><span lang="EN" bis_size='{"x":8,"y":1200,"w":615,"h":56,"abs_x":310,"abs_y":2193}'>You can go for cotton blended lightweight knitwear which are lighter and gentle and good for fluctuating weather from warm to mild cold. Also, you should be choosing knitwear which has looser weaves for better air circulation. They are <a href="https://www.wichitanewspaper.com/">stylish</a> and good for your mild climate too. <p bis_size='{"x":525,"y":1240,"w":0,"h":16,"abs_x":827,"abs_y":2233}'></p></span></p>
<h3 bis_size='{"x":8,"y":1274,"w":636,"h":20,"abs_x":310,"abs_y":2267}'><a name="_jeb3422ca6cw" style="background-image: url('data:image/svg+xml;charset=UTF-8,%3Csvg%20width%3D'8'%20height%3D'12'%20xmlns%3D'http%3A%2F%2Fwww.w3.org%2F2000%2Fsvg'%3E%3Cpath%20d%3D'M0%200L8%200%208%2012%204.09117821%209%200%2012z'%2F%3E%3C%2Fsvg%3E%0A');" bis_label="style" bis_size='{"x":8,"y":1278,"w":12,"h":12,"abs_x":310,"abs_y":2271}' rel="nofollow"></a><span lang="EN" bis_size='{"x":20,"y":1275,"w":150,"h":18,"abs_x":322,"abs_y":2268}'>Cashmere knitwear<p bis_size='{"x":170,"y":1275,"w":0,"h":18,"abs_x":472,"abs_y":2268}'></p></span></h3>
<p class="MsoNormal" bis_size='{"x":8,"y":1311,"w":636,"h":60,"abs_x":310,"abs_y":2304}'><span lang="EN" bis_size='{"x":8,"y":1313,"w":625,"h":56,"abs_x":310,"abs_y":2306}'>Cashmere is great, its soft, warm and can adapt to weather conditions. If you have sensitive skin, its good for you because cashmere is hypoallergenic and it regulates body temperature with its moisture wicking. <p bis_size='{"x":57,"y":1353,"w":0,"h":16,"abs_x":359,"abs_y":2346}'></p></span></p>
<h3 bis_size='{"x":8,"y":1387,"w":636,"h":20,"abs_x":310,"abs_y":2380}'><a name="_xyi4d1dempm" style="background-image: url('data:image/svg+xml;charset=UTF-8,%3Csvg%20width%3D'8'%20height%3D'12'%20xmlns%3D'http%3A%2F%2Fwww.w3.org%2F2000%2Fsvg'%3E%3Cpath%20d%3D'M0%200L8%200%208%2012%204.09117821%209%200%2012z'%2F%3E%3C%2Fsvg%3E%0A');" bis_label="style" bis_size='{"x":8,"y":1391,"w":12,"h":12,"abs_x":310,"abs_y":2384}' rel="nofollow"></a><span lang="EN" bis_size='{"x":20,"y":1388,"w":231,"h":18,"abs_x":322,"abs_y":2381}'>Choose merino wool knitwear<p bis_size='{"x":251,"y":1388,"w":0,"h":18,"abs_x":553,"abs_y":2381}'></p></span></h3>
<p class="MsoNormal" bis_size='{"x":8,"y":1423,"w":636,"h":80,"abs_x":310,"abs_y":2416}'><span lang="EN" bis_size='{"x":8,"y":1425,"w":634,"h":76,"abs_x":310,"abs_y":2418}'>Merino wool is like a gold standard for Australian conditions, its naturally temperature-regulating, moisture-wicking, and also odor-resistant which will be a great choice if your Aussie hometown has unpredictable weather. Its fibers stay warm in winter and also help you stay cool when the temperature increases.<p bis_size='{"x":71,"y":1485,"w":0,"h":16,"abs_x":373,"abs_y":2478}'></p></span></p>
<h3 bis_size='{"x":8,"y":1520,"w":636,"h":20,"abs_x":310,"abs_y":2513}'><a name="_m194ahkuec6t" style="background-image: url('data:image/svg+xml;charset=UTF-8,%3Csvg%20width%3D'8'%20height%3D'12'%20xmlns%3D'http%3A%2F%2Fwww.w3.org%2F2000%2Fsvg'%3E%3Cpath%20d%3D'M0%200L8%200%208%2012%204.09117821%209%200%2012z'%2F%3E%3C%2Fsvg%3E%0A');" bis_label="style" bis_size='{"x":8,"y":1524,"w":12,"h":12,"abs_x":310,"abs_y":2517}' rel="nofollow"></a><span lang="EN" bis_size='{"x":20,"y":1521,"w":178,"h":18,"abs_x":322,"abs_y":2514}'>Choose loose knitwear <p bis_size='{"x":198,"y":1521,"w":0,"h":18,"abs_x":500,"abs_y":2514}'></p></span></h3>
<p class="MsoNormal" bis_size='{"x":8,"y":1556,"w":636,"h":60,"abs_x":310,"abs_y":2549}'><span lang="EN" bis_size='{"x":8,"y":1558,"w":605,"h":56,"abs_x":310,"abs_y":2551}'>If youre buying knitwear that is too tight around your waist and overall body, itll cause a lot of discomfort when the temperature will change, so look for lighter pieces thatll help you layer better without the heavy bulk and for the chilly Aussie areas, you should still consider normal fit knitwear. <p bis_size='{"x":613,"y":1598,"w":0,"h":16,"abs_x":915,"abs_y":2591}'></p></span></p>
